Full Time
GB, SE1 9BB

Data Engineer | London | TUI

As a Data Engineer within our Global Marketing Technology team, you will play a pivotal role in technically delivering our data and analytical integrations and solutions alongside a talented multi-disciplinary team, comprising of software engineering and QA.  You will be passionate about working with data and ensuring we build products that exposes the value of that data.

 

The Marketing Technology team has a commitment to deliver a connected, real time Global Marketing Platform (GMP) for all markets across Europe. The transformation and development of GMP is ever increasing and the ability to implement a continuous feature delivery pipeline is key to its success. You’ll be joining an exciting, new team to develop industry leading solutions to meet business needs.

 

We are headquartered in Germany, with an international office network in London, Luton, Hanover, Porto and Berlin to mention few.

 

TUI group sees the application of data and analytics as a core source of competitive advantage in the drive to deliver market leading personalised customer experiences which maximise the value captured from our extensive product range whilst operating at maximum efficiency. We have embarked on a journey of development towards a more digital, connected and integrated future. But we haven’t arrived there yet. Join us now and shape the future of travel.

 

What you will be doing:

 

We are looking for a strong Data Engineer to join our growing team; The ideal candidate is experienced in data pipeline production and data collection, responsibilities will include ingesting, expanding and optimizing our data into marketing technologies, as well as optimizing data flow and collection for cross functional teams from various platforms. In addition, you’ll work with Software engineers to automate the ingestion of data & assets into the GMP to allow for on demand & real time personalized Marketing. Furthermore, work will include the push of data back into our Global Data Platforms for improved ML, BI & data enrichment.

 

The Data Engineer will work closely with a team of front end developers, other data engineers and analysts on data initiatives to ensure optimal data delivery architecture is consistent throughout ongoing projects. The ideal candidate must be self-directed and comfortable supporting the data needs of multiple teams, systems and products. The right candidate will be excited by the prospect of optimizing and supporting the re-design of our company’s data architecture to support our next generation of analytic and data initiatives.

 

You will be integral to the digital transformation journey and the success of this for TUI by maintaining, improving and driving best practices with respect to our data. This role will act as the bridge between our backend IT function and the business marketing teams and work on delivering crucial data solutions to meet the needs of the business.

 

  • You will manage the pipelining (collection, ingestion, access), engineering (cleansing, feature creation / selection) and understanding (documentation, exploration) of this data.
  • You will create sustainable real time feeds of data that underpin our marketing activities
  • Acquire, create and manage innovative yet stable data assets for the team.
  • Work closely with software developers, data analysts, data scientists, and decision-makers, such as product owners, to build solutions and gain novel insights.
  • Evaluate user requests for new or re-engineered analytics and reporting solutions to determine their feasibility and time requirements, and their compatibility with current systems and architecture standards.
  • Active participation in the development of the data lake and data marts and subsequent enhancements, including the creation of new data solutions to support development of analytic capabilities
  • Interact with stakeholders regarding data availability and report format/presentation, to ensure the report provides the information the stakeholder’s needs without compromising the report's accuracy
  • Deliver new capabilities to the business through agile delivery methods, so a working knowledge and experience of Agile, Scrum and Jira would also benefit the candidate.

 

What we are looking for:

 

  • Hands on experience bringing event based, real time data into Marketing Technologies.
  • The ability to design, implement and use effective database structures to ensure data is organised effectively and ready for downstream development of data science and analytics.
  • Experience working in a structured environment and desire for good documentation, exceptional delivery, effective organisation, and high-quality communication with team and customers.
  • Experience of Big Data platforms, enabling non-technical users to gain insight into key business metrics
  • Hands on experience with modern "Big Data" systems (e.g. Amazon RedShift, AWS, Snowflake, Athena, Glue, Caspian) 
  • Familiarity with a traditional BI application such as Power BI, Tableau or Spotfire
  • Strong SQL and data profiling skills is a must
  • Excellent knowledge of data types including JSON, XML, CSV etc.
  • Solid understanding of data warehousing principles, concepts and best practices (e.g. ODS, Data Mart, Data Lakes)
  • Comfortable working with SQL / NoSQL
  • Understanding of the contemporary data engineering and analytics landscape, the current tools, the pertinent approaches and the likely challenges.
  • Experience of both modern compiled & dynamic scripting languages: e.g. node, Scala, python. 
  • Strong problem solving and analytic skills

 

TUI and you

  • Competitive salary
  • Pension scheme, life assurance and options to buy shares
  • Generous holiday entitlement & holiday discounts
  • Forward thinking ways of working
  • TUI time off, purchase of additional holiday entitlement
  • Excellent rates with foreign exchange and discounts with retailers

 

TUI Group’s vision is to make travel experiences special. To fulfil this vision, we never stop looking ahead, seeking new ways to delight our customers and grow our business. We recognise the power of digital and the massive contribution this brings to creating a truly unique and differentiated customer experience.

 

TUI Group is the leading tourism business with over 70,000 employees internationally, across more than 100 countries. The Group umbrella consists of strong tour operators, 1,600 travel agencies and leading online portals, five airlines with more than 150 aircraft, over 380 hotels, twelve cruise liners and countless incoming agencies in all major holiday destinations around the globe.

 

If you want to know more about why TUI Group is the world’s leading tourism group, and our continuing work in the diversity & inclusion space, simply visit careers.tuigroup.com